Output 21f92eb6f9087877e77dafca7e2c168690da487fd6d1c79c8a8c0d5ab8db449b:3

value
12915521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afd8db16fc180d99d6222ef4bc2b26515764ed3e OP_EQUAL
address
MPvxGQZPmL3FQXmTEjdD3HQhFwZm9hGQAu
transaction
21f92eb6f9087877e77dafca7e2c168690da487fd6d1c79c8a8c0d5ab8db449b
spent
true